From 67cdddfa5122cc8139c7fe91834952b5abdb77ec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nuno Sa Date: Mon, 12 Aug 2024 15:48:21 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] plugins: adrv9002: allow control RF state in pin mode There's now the possibility of still controlling the port RF enable state mode even if the port mode is set to pin. That's possible in case the driver is in control of the pin controlling the port. Hence, let's check if the driver supports that at the plugin initialization and act accordingly.
